Bayhealth Medical Center is a fully integrated healthcare system consisting of two hospitals (Kent Campus and Sussex Campus), and two free-standing EDs (in Smyrna and Milton) along with numerous ambulatory and outpatient offices. Both hospital sites are certified Primary Stroke Centers. There is 24/7 Hospitalist coverage at both hospitals, as well as Intensivists in the ICU s. Back up is available in most specialties including Neurosurgery, Cardiac surgery, Interventional and Structural Cardiology. The Kent Campus hospital has a NICU and a robust MFM program. Milford has OB Hospitalists that see all ED related OB/GYN cases (over 20 weeks). Kent has a Cardiac ICU, a Neuro ICU and a general ICU, Milford has a general ICU. In-patient Pediatrics patients are covered by Pediatric Hospitalists at Kent General Hospital. Kent also has a 14 bed observation unit run by ED APP s with private attendings rounding.

Our Sussex Campus hospital opened in February 2019 with double the ED capacity as the retiring hospital and an additional 12 observation unit beds. With increased services the volumes have continued to grow!
